never trolled flys much, what size dodger do you guys run in front? Do you run strictly dodgers or do you run some sort of rotator ? Any advice appreciated.

I have had tons of success using a red coyote 8" with 18 inches of leader about 10lb flouro, going to Joe's smelt or and alewife pattern fly. When I get desperate I use it.
Speeds I use are just under 3mph. Never higher, my best luck has been using it while slowing down and it does the dodger movement. Not quite spinning but yawing. Makes them commit I've noticed.
I only run it maybe 15ft behind my downrigger weight because you inevitably get line twist from the spinning.
That flasher I use works real well behind a slide diver too. Just don't put your line into the trip arm. That combo has boated me plenty of dinners and a few fish worthy of conversation.
